Hematocrit (HCT) is the percentage of red blood cells in circulation and provides similar information as the RBC. WebOverview. A complete blood count, also known as haematology, examines the blood cells in the body. There are two types of blood cell, red blood cells (RBCs) and white blood cells (WBCs). White blood cells help to determine whether a cat has an infection or inflammation. Red blood cells help to determine whether a cat is anaemic. high hemp delta 8 disposable
